Previously per-worktree references in index, detached HEAD or per-worktree reflogs come from current worktree only, not all worktrees. The series deals with git-prune and git-gc specifically. I left out "git rev-list". It shares the same problem because it will only consider current worktree's HEAD, index and per-worktree reflogs. The problem is I am not sure if we simply just change, say --indexed-objects, to cover all indexes, or should we only do that with "--all-worktrees --indexed-objects". I guess this is up for discussion.
